What Does an Accident Lawsuit Attorney Do?
An accident lawsuit attorney is accountable for guiding clients through the complex procedure of submitting an accident claim. Here are some crucial obligations:
| Responsibilities | Description |
|---|---|
| Assess the Case | Examine the information of the accident and its impact on the victim's life. |
| Gather Evidence | Gather relevant details, consisting of police reports, medical records, and witness declarations. |
| Work out Settlements | Communicate with insurer to reach an acceptable settlement for the customer. |
| File Lawsuits | Prepare and file legal files required for starting a lawsuit if negotiations stop working. |
| Represent Clients in Court | Supporter on behalf of customers throughout court proceedings, if the case goes to trial. |

Typical Types of Cases Handled by Accident Lawsuit Attorneys
Accident lawsuit lawyers handle a wide variety of cases. Here are some typical types:
| Type of Accident | Secret Considerations |
|---|---|
| Car Accidents | Figuring out fault, assessing damages, negotiating with insurance business. |
| Slip and Fall | Establishing residential or commercial property owner carelessness, collecting evidence of risky conditions. |
| Office Injuries | Browsing workers' compensation claims and company liability. |
| Medical Malpractice | Showing neglect by health care professionals and acquiring expert testaments. |
| Item Liability | Showing that a product is malfunctioning and led to injury. |
The Process of Filing an Accident Lawsuit
Filing an accident lawsuit can be a complex treatment that includes several actions:
Initial Consultation
- The attorney consults with the client to go over the details of the accident and evaluate the case's practicality.
Examination
- The attorney gathers evidence and appropriate information to develop a strong case.
Demand Letter
- A need letter is sent to the accountable party or their insurance provider, outlining the claim and the compensation sought.
Settlement
- The attorney participates in settlements to reach a settlement that pleases the customer's requirements.
Submitting a Lawsuit
- If settlements stop working, the attorney files a lawsuit in the proper court.
Discovery Phase
- Both celebrations exchange evidence, and witnesses may be deposed.
Trial

- If no settlement is reached, the case may continue to trial, where the attorney represents the client in court.
Often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. How much does it cost to hire an accident lawsuit attorney?
Many Accident Compensation Attorney lawsuit lawyers deal with a contingency charge basis, indicating they just make money if you win your case. Normally, the charge varies from 25% to 40% of the settlement or award amount.
2. For how long do I need to file a lawsuit after an accident?
The statute of constraints differs by jurisdiction but is generally in between one to three years from the date of the accident. It's vital to seek advice from an attorney to ensure your claim is filed in time.
3. What kinds of compensation can I receive?
Victims can get compensation for medical expenses, lost earnings, pain and suffering, emotional distress, and home damage. An attorney can help evaluate the complete degree of potential damages.
4. Will my case go to trial?
Not all cases go to trial. Many personal injury cases are settled through settlement. Nevertheless, if a fair settlement can not be reached, a lawsuit may be required.
